Lam Dong announces National Treasure Avalokitesvara statue in Bac Binh

The Avalokitesvara Bac Binh statue is one of the typical works, representing the transitional period from the 8th - 9th century plastic art style to the peak period of Champa art.

On the morning of September 14, at Lam Dong Provincial Museum (Xuan Huong Ward, Da Lat), Lam Dong Provincial People's Committee held a ceremony to announce the Prime Minister's decision to recognize the Avalokitesvara Bac Binh statue dating from the 8th-9th century as a National Treasure.

The program to announce the National Treasure of the Avalokitesvara statue of Bac Binh and the opening of the Cultural, Music and Cuisine Space of Ethnic Groups and the exhibition of artifacts, images and introduction of typical books of the province at Lam Dong Museum are among the main activities of "Lam Dong Tourism Destination Experience Month 2025."

The Avalokitesvara Statue of Bac Binh was recognized as a National Treasure by the Prime Minister under Decision No. 1712/QD-TTg dated December 31, 2024. This is a masterpiece of Champa art, reflecting the strong cultural exchange between Cham culture and Indian culture, crafted from dark gray sandstone, 61 cm high, weighing 13 kg, dating from the 8th-9th century.

This artifact was accidentally discovered by local people before 1945 while farming in Bac Binh.

In 1996, the statue was hidden in a local resident's garden. In 2001, the Avalokitesvara statue was handed over to the Binh Thuan Provincial Museum (formerly) for management, preservation and display.

The Avalokitesvara statue in Bac Binh is one of the typical works, representing the transitional period from the 8th - 9th century plastic art style to the peak period of Champa art (9th - 10th century).

With unique historical, artistic and scientific values, the statues are a valuable source of material for studying the history of sculpture and religious art of Champa culture.

Speaking at the opening ceremony, Mr. Dinh Van Tuan, Vice Chairman of Lam Dong Provincial People's Committee, emphasized that in order to protect and effectively exploit the value of the National Treasure of Avalokitesvara Statue of Bac Binh, the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ism needs to focus on communication and promotion, introducing the historical, cultural and scientific values ​​of the treasure; at the same time, introducing other unique cultural heritages of the province to raise public awareness and attract tourists, contributing to the development of cultural tourism, promoting the local socio-economy.

After the announcement ceremony, there were also music and art performances; introduction of cuisine and traditional crafts of Lam Dong ethnic groups. Along with that was a space for displaying and exhibiting images of local culture, relics and landscapes; and introduction of typical books in the Lam Dong Provincial Museum.

According to the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ism of Lam Dong province, the locality currently owns 7 cultural heritages recognized by UNESCO. Specifically, including the Central Highlands Gong Culture Space, Dak Nong UNESCO Global Geopark, Southern amateur music art, Cham pottery art, Nguyen Dynasty Woodblocks World Documentary Heritage, Lang Biang World Biosphere Reserve and Da Lat participating in the UNESCO Creative City of Music network.

In addition, the province also has 10 national intangible cultural heritages; 3 special national relics; 144 historical - cultural relics and scenic spots ranked by the State. In particular, Lam Dong Provincial Museum currently preserves and displays 112,235 artifacts, antiques, documents of historical, cultural and artistic value, including 3 national treasures: Dak Son lithophone, golden Linga and Avalokitesvara statue of Bac Binh./.
